Resetting your armpit

from synthetic "testosterone killer" fragrances to pure organic scents

For years your skin has been trained to fear itself.

Industrial fragrances do not eliminate odor — they suppress it, overwrite it, and coat it in laboratory masculinity.

The armpit is not dirty. It is apocrine.

It produces proteins and lipids that your skin microbiome transforms into scent — your scent. When drenched in synthetic perfumes and antibacterial soaps, that ecosystem becomes confused, aggressive, reactive.

Resetting is not detox folklore.

It is ecological correction.

We remove the artificial noise.

We rebalance pH.

We let the skin remember how to regulate itself.

This is not about smelling like nothing.

It is about smelling alive — but intentional.

1st: Apple cider vinegar

Diluted apple cider vinegar is the first real step.

The skin’s natural pH is slightly acidic (around 4.5–5.5). Most industrial soaps are alkaline — they disrupt that balance, strip oils, and leave the skin vulnerable. Vinegar gently re-acidifies the surface, discouraging odor-causing bacteria while supporting the beneficial ones.

Mix 1 part apple cider vinegar with 2–3 parts water.

Apply. Let it dry. Do not panic at the smell — it evaporates.

It is sharp. It is clarifying. It is the ritual blade.

If you must use industrial soap, use it lightly. Better: tallow soap, simple and ancestral. The goal is not to sterilize your body — it is to stop declaring war on it.

(Sí, industrial soaps are aura-killing. But we transition strategically, not dramatically.)

2nd: Greek yogurt (optional but sensually creamy)

Greek yogurt is not a necessity.

It is a softness.

Rich in lactic acid and live cultures, it gently exfoliates while introducing beneficial bacteria to the skin. Applied for 5–10 minutes and rinsed, it leaves behind something unexpected: a faint, warm dairy trace that mingles beautifully with body hair and clean skin.

Not sweet.

Not sour.

Alive.

This step is for those who understand that scent is not erased — it is composed.

It feels ancient. Pastoral. Almost obscene in its simplicity.
